22233d2500723e5594f3e7c70896ffeeef32b9c950ywanstatic double compute_psnr(const vpx_image_t *img1,
23233d2500723e5594f3e7c70896ffeeef32b9c950ywan                           const vpx_image_t *img2) {
24233d2500723e5594f3e7c70896ffeeef32b9c950ywan  assert((img1->fmt == img2->fmt) &&
25233d2500723e5594f3e7c70896ffeeef32b9c950ywan         (img1->d_w == img2->d_w) &&
26233d2500723e5594f3e7c70896ffeeef32b9c950ywan         (img1->d_h == img2->d_h));
27233d2500723e5594f3e7c70896ffeeef32b9c950ywan
28233d2500723e5594f3e7c70896ffeeef32b9c950ywan  const unsigned int width_y  = img1->d_w;
29233d2500723e5594f3e7c70896ffeeef32b9c950ywan  const unsigned int height_y = img1->d_h;
30233d2500723e5594f3e7c70896ffeeef32b9c950ywan  unsigned int i, j;
31233d2500723e5594f3e7c70896ffeeef32b9c950ywan
32233d2500723e5594f3e7c70896ffeeef32b9c950ywan  int64_t sqrerr = 0;
33233d2500723e5594f3e7c70896ffeeef32b9c950ywan  for (i = 0; i < height_y; ++i)
34233d2500723e5594f3e7c70896ffeeef32b9c950ywan    for (j = 0; j < width_y; ++j) {
35233d2500723e5594f3e7c70896ffeeef32b9c950ywan      int64_t d = img1->planes[VPX_PLANE_Y][i * img1->stride[VPX_PLANE_Y] + j] -
36233d2500723e5594f3e7c70896ffeeef32b9c950ywan                  img2->planes[VPX_PLANE_Y][i * img2->stride[VPX_PLANE_Y] + j];
37233d2500723e5594f3e7c70896ffeeef32b9c950ywan      sqrerr += d * d;
38233d2500723e5594f3e7c70896ffeeef32b9c950ywan    }
39233d2500723e5594f3e7c70896ffeeef32b9c950ywan  double mse = static_cast<double>(sqrerr) / (width_y * height_y);
40233d2500723e5594f3e7c70896ffeeef32b9c950ywan  double psnr = 100.0;
41233d2500723e5594f3e7c70896ffeeef32b9c950ywan  if (mse > 0.0) {
42233d2500723e5594f3e7c70896ffeeef32b9c950ywan    psnr = 10 * log10(255.0 * 255.0 / mse);
43233d2500723e5594f3e7c70896ffeeef32b9c950ywan  }
44233d2500723e5594f3e7c70896ffeeef32b9c950ywan  return psnr;
45233d2500723e5594f3e7c70896ffeeef32b9c950ywan}
